Be our next Project Manager / Senior Electrical Engineer (Mining)!
Your work environment at EXP
In this role, you will be a part of the Mining Team, based out of any of our US offices!
What a day at EXP has in store for you
* Preparing proposals for projects for geotechnical services for engineering projects that include cost estimates and timelines;
* PLC, Power, Automation and instrumentation mining experience required.
* Responsible for meeting firm's engineering quality levels of discipline on assigned projects.
* Oversees development of design concepts by Designers, and ensure proper application and execution.
* Verifies Designer's work quality regarding specifications, reports, code application, submittal review, equipment selection, deliverables, and drawings.
* Responsible for applying the EXP's risk management practices of electrical engineering.
* Have a solid understanding of engineering fundamentals and advanced concepts to execute all required aspects of discipline engineering.
* Encourages collaboration to seek the best solutions.
* Manages work plans and deliverables on multiple projects within budgeted hours.
* Executes complex electrical designs with conflicting design requirements or difficult coordination.
* Perform front-end loading of Electrical systems for projects.
* Contributes to revisions of EXP's design standards and master specifications.
* Evaluates Value Engineering (cost cutting) items with respect to our level of risk.
* Edits and develops the basis of design narratives documenting the project scope.
* Develops electrical one-lines, load lists, area classifications, etc.
* Participates in HAZOP, PHA, safety reviews.
What your experience looks like
*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ering from an Accredited University.
* Registered PE Required
* 10 plus years of experience in the mining or industrial industry.
* Business development experienced required
The salary range for this role is $110,000 to $150,000. Actual compensation will be determined based on a variety of factors, including but not limited to the candidate's skill set, experience, certifications, and geographic location. Compensation may vary by location due to differences in the cost of labor.
In addition to competitive pay, we offer a comprehensive benefits package for all full-time employees, including health insurance, vacation time, and 401(k) retirement benefits.
